Athletics
The Shelbyville Grady Clays compete in these sports -
Volleyball, Cross Country, Football, Basketball, Powerlifting, Track, Baseball & Softball
State Titles
*Baseball
**1988(2A)
*Boys Basketball
UIL Boys Basketball Archives
**1982(2A), 1984(2A) 2019(2A) 2020(2A)
